It could be that you don’t have third party cookies enabled on your browser. https://en.support.wordpress.com/third-party-cookies/
It could be that you are not using correct and complete video shortcodes.

We embed videos into pages and posts and no upgrade is required unless or until you exceed your free media space allocation. https://en.support.wordpress.com/space-upgrade/The video embeds in posts and pages that WordPress.com supports for all of our blogs – no upgrade required are found here.
http://en.support.wordpress.com/videos/Video shortcodes are here http://en.support.wordpress.com/shortcodes/#video
Note to post your own videos requires a videopress upgrade unless they are on youtube or another source site that is supported and the videopress support doc location is https://en.support.wordpress.com/videopress/ As a workaround, keep in mind that you can also upload your media to another service like youtube videos and insert it into your posts from there.
